Chimney Rock Four Seasons Trail & Hickory Nut Falls Trail Hike

Поділитися
Вставка
  • Опубліковано 7 жов 2024
  • Today I head back to Chimney Rock State Park in Chimney Rock North Carolina. I'll be hiking on the Four Seasons Trail, which proceeds to the Hickory Nut Falls Trail. The hike ends at the 400+ foot Hickory Nut Falls which is a spectacular site to see!

    Great video thanks so much!!! Trying to plan a trip to this park with our 7 year old daughter...Could you confirm that this trail is not too dangerous tricky long or anything else bad??? Recommendations on footwear...we are city mice!!!! Thanks again!!!!

    • @lindakiser1349
      @lindakiser1349 2 роки тому

      Definitely the Hickory Nut Falls portion of the trail is very easy! But if your 7 yr old enjoys the outdoors and is energetic, he/she could probably do any of the Chimney Rock Trails....and likely hang with it longer than us older folks can. Also, you can turn back anytime you like. If you're particularly interested in going onto "the rock" you have the option to ride an elevator up to the last staircase to the rock. Trail runners would be adequate for the hiking.

      Hello when we did this hike the kids were all smaller but able to manage just fine. I do always recommend bringing a little 1st aid kit just in case someone slips and scrapes their knee or the like. I usually just wear a nice comfortable pair of tennis shoes as well as the kids. They sell walking sticks that are nice souvenirs and fun to help on the trail, or just pick up a nice stick from a tree if you'd like. There are maps provided and park rangers you can ask any questions to assist. As mentioned before you can always turn back for shorter walks. One thing I like about this particular trail is it's almost all under the tree canopy and very pretty. Hope this helps and enjoy Chimney Rock!
